Canon SX160 IS vs Samsung PL170 Overview

In this write-up, we are evaluating the Canon SX160 IS and Samsung PL170, one being a Small Sensor Superzoom and the other is a Ultracompact by manufacturers Canon and Samsung. The sensor resolution of the SX160 IS (16MP) and the PL170 (16MP) is fairly well matched and they possess the same exact sensor dimensions (1/2.3").

The SX160 IS was revealed 2 years later than the PL170 and that is quite a big gap as far as technology is concerned. The two cameras offer different body type with the Canon SX160 IS being a Compact camera and the Samsung PL170 being a Ultracompact camera.

Canon SX160 IS vs Samsung PL170 Physical Comparison

For anyone who is going to carry your camera frequently, you'll need to factor in its weight and volume. The Canon SX160 IS enjoys exterior dimensions of 111mm x 73mm x 44mm (4.4" x 2.9" x 1.7") along with a weight of 291 grams (0.64 lbs) while the Samsung PL170 has sizing of 95mm x 57mm x 19mm (3.7" x 2.2" x 0.7") with a weight of n/a grams (0.00 lbs).

Canon SX160 IS vs Samsung PL170 Sensor Comparison

Quite often, it can be difficult to picture the contrast between sensor sizing only by looking at a spec sheet. The photograph underneath might offer you a much better sense of the sensor dimensions in the SX160 IS and PL170.

Clearly, each of the cameras offer the same exact sensor sizing and the same MP and you should expect similar quality of photos although you have to take the release date of the products into consideration. The younger SX160 IS provides an advantage with regard to sensor technology.
